“Carnival of Doom!”

A skeletal horde descends on Jonah Hex and a terrified blonde woman in this striking 1984 DC Western-horror mashup, with grinning, bone-white skeletons looming over both figures in a scene of pure dread. The cover — penciled by Ed Hannigan and inked by Tony DeZuniga — perfectly sets the stage for "Carnival of Doom!," suggesting that Hex's world is about to get a lot more supernatural than your average frontier showdown. Michael Fleisher and Tony DeZuniga's creative partnership was in fine form here, delivering the kind of darkly imaginative storytelling that made this series stand out from the Western crowd.
